[The civil rights march from Selma to Montgomery, Alabama in 1965]
Summary
Photograph shows some participants in the civil rights march sitting on a wall resting, one holds a placard which reads, "We march together, Catholics, Jews, Protestant, for dignity and brotherhood of all men under God, Now!"
Contact sheet 11, frame 0.
Photograph printed in 1999 or 2000 by the photographer from his original negatives.
